In the title compound, sodium N-chlorobenzenesulfonamide sesquihydrate, Na(+).C(6)H(5)ClNO(2)S(-).1.5H(2)O, the sodium ion exhibits octahedral coordination by O atoms from three water molecules and by three sulfonyl O atoms of three different N-chlorobenzenesulfonamide anions. A two-dimensional polymeric layer consists of units, each comprising two face-sharing octahedra which share four corners with four other such units, the layer running parallel to the ab plane. The water molecules participate in hydrogen bonds of the types O-H...O, O-H...N and O-H...Cl.Entities:
